Welcome to Mario’s Seawall Italian Restaurant, Galveston’s favorite Italian restaurant. At Mario’s, we offer a unique dining experience with a blend of authentic Italian cuisine and a Texas-size seaside view. With over many years of experience, we have established ourselves as one of the oldest and best Italian restaurants in Galveston. Our menu features a variety of classic Italian dishes, including handmade pastas, brick-oven pizzas, & fresh seafood options. Our dishes are made using only the freshest ingredients & authentic recipes, ensuring a taste of Italy with every bite. Sunday Brunch – served from 11am to 2pm, featuring popular dishes like our Lobster Eggs Benedict, Steak & Eggs, Chicken & Waffles, and the best Bloody Marys in town

Spacious Italian eatery with mosaic walls offers classic entrees including lobster ravioli & gelato.

We are in town for a small vacation and our group decided it was time for lunch. My co-worker who has been coming here for 50+ years said this is a must in Galveston and boy did they not disappoint! My daughter got the Alfredo (the sauce was unlike any I’ve ever had, so delicious), I got the lunch Momma Mia Slice and was not expecting the size, but it was some of the best pizza I’ve ever had, my husband got the fried calamari and blackened shrimp and he said it was fantastic! Erica was our waitress and checked on us often. She took my daughter to get her free scoop of ice cream (homemade gelato)-for a kid who doesn’t like ice cream she was very fond of it! Mario’s is definitely a great spot to enjoy!
